What is “so kar uthne ki dua”?

So “kar uthne ki dua” means “the supplication, dua, or prayer that is supposed to be recited in case one wakes up after sleeping.” “According to the Holy Quran, sleep is seen as a minor death since Allah is the one who takes away souls; Allah gives a new life after need during both death and sleep. He also brings the souls of those for whom death has been predetermined and sends the remainder to be woken in what the Islamic tradition refers to as death. Qur’an 39:42).

Why Recite So Kar Uthne Ki Dua?

  1. Acknowledgement of Allah’s Mercy: Sleeping temporarily separates the soul. Waking awake is a blessing. Because of that grace, we give thanks to Allah.
  2. Guard Against Satan’s Plot: According to the Prophet ﷺ, Satan ties three knots on the back of the sleeper’s skull when he says, “Remain sleeping.” Through prayer, wudu, and recollection, the knots are released.
  3. Begin the Day With Dhikr: Spiritually, the first waking is priceless. Worship, as opposed to detachment, envelops the day, starting with recollection.
  4. Seek Forgiveness and Guidance: By pleading for forgiveness and sympathy, the comprehensive dua compels us to be mindful.
